The Role of Software in Laser Sheet Cutting Efficiency

Software acts as the conductor, coordinating the complex interplay of machine parameters, material properties, and cutting strategies.
By precisely controlling laser power, speed, and focus, software ensures pristine cuts with minimal burrs and distortion. It eliminates the need for manual adjustments, reducing operator error and ensuring consistent results. Advanced algorithms analyze the material’s characteristics and adjust cutting parameters accordingly, optimizing the cutting process for each unique workpiece.
Software also plays a pivotal role in nesting, the efficient arrangement of parts on the sheet. By utilizing sophisticated algorithms, it minimizes material waste and maximizes cutting efficiency. It eliminates trial and error, allowing for faster and more cost-effective production.
Furthermore, software facilitates real-time monitoring and control of the cutting process. With a connected user interface, operators can remotely monitor machine performance, adjust parameters, and troubleshoot issues in real-time. This reduces downtime, improves machine utilization, and ensures the highest levels of productivity.
